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 ALMA TERRACE Terraced £133,927 £77,500 14 Jan 2011
4 ALMA TERRACE Terraced £130,543 £75,000 22 Sep 2011
5 ALMA TERRACE Terraced £140,779 £113,000 25 Apr 2019
7 ALMA TERRACE Terraced £183,635 £96,000 28 Oct 2004
8 ALMA TERRACE Terraced £195,274 £105,000 1 Jun 2005
9 ALMA TERRACE Terraced £118,076 £115,000 31 May 2022
10 ALMA TERRACE Terraced £156,060 £85,000 14 Oct 2005
12 ALMA TERRACE Terraced £134,420 £108,000 14 Jun 2019